    Step *Check with your Internet service provider about Internet connection options. The speed of your Internet connection is the most significant variable to your download speed. If you have dial-up Internet access, consider upgrading to a Direct Service Line (DSL) or a cable connection. Even if you already have cable, your Internet service provider may have faster cable services available.

    Step 2Understand a fast connection. Connection speed is measured by the amount of data that can be transferred per second, usually kilobits per second (Kbps) or megabits per second (Mbps). There are *024 kilobits in one megabit. Most dial-up connections are 56 Kbps, while cable can be as fast as 20 Mbps. When you contact your Internet service provider, they should be able to tell you the speed of their connections.
